When I'm drawing a Statechart for an Actor (right-click on the Actor in the tree, choose Statechart), all the States I'm putting on that diagram are positioned in the tree under the Package, not Actor (the diagram itself is placed under Actor, as expected).

The same behaviour I've noticed for classes in the Logical view as well.

Why is it so? What if two actors/classes in a package have states with the same name (i.e., "Idle")?
